Head of Treasury (Contract Role) Reporting to the CFO, the Head of Treasury is responsible for leading the Treasury and Accounts payable teams. The role is responsible for ensuring that the Spirit Energy group efficiently manages its liquidity, pays vendors on time, identifies and reduces FX and commodity risk and operates within the parameters set in the Treasury Policy. Contract Duration One year Time Type Full Time Responsibilities Part of the Finance Leadership team involved in setting the strategy for the Finance function. Accountable for managing Spirit Energy’s liquidity and cash balances including instigating deposits, optimising the banking footprint and ensuring availability of adequate working capital facilities. Alongside the Commercial Team, jointly responsible for the management and optimization of bank guarantees, parent company guarantees and letters of credit, bank accounts and escrow accounts including the Decommissioning Security Agreements. Accountable for managing intercompany loan positions, cash centralisation and dividends while maintaining the integrity of the inter-company loan matrix and ensuring compliance with legal and operational guidelines. Responsible for the integrity of all accounting in Spirit Energy Treasury Limited. Responsible for identification, execution and management of FX and commodity hedges to mitigate currency risk within the Company’s operations and financing structure. Manage processes, policies and controls to support robust reporting, ensure timely and effective financial/management reporting and relevant forecasting of treasury activity and hedge positions to the CFO and the Board. Ensure all ledgers are maintained, supplier and customer reconciliations and reports are completed accurately and on time (for example GRIR). Responsible for the aged creditors, to ensure no monthly/year-end surprises, and co‑ordinate the aged debt and aged creditor review with the wider Finance Operations team. Ensure issues are resolved quickly for all internal and external stakeholders. Lead the annual reviews of the Treasury policy, Commodity Hedging Policy, Treasury and Banking delegation of authority, bank mandates and bank portal access. Ensure the integrity of the Treasury management system, Medius AP system and all banking systems. Always seek improvement in process or systems to further minimise costs and increase efficiency in the function. Build and maintain positive working relationships with Shareholder Treasury Functions, Spirit’s banking relationship managers and any other key stakeholders. Builds and leads a high‑performing team, is accountable for team performance and delivery as well as their wellbeing and development. Manages and develops the Treasury and AP teams, supporting cross‑functional knowledge and maintain documentation of all Treasury and AP processes. About you You’ll need to have an accounting qualification such as ACCA, CIMA, ICAEW or ICAS and a relevant University Degree. You will also have a Corporate Treasurers qualification. Previous relevant recent treasury experience, ideally in a large multi‑currency and corporate oil and gas environment is ideal.
